## Messaging Principles for Developers
### DO:
-**Be specific** - Use concrete technical details
-**Show code** - Developers want to see, not read
-**State limitations** - Honest about what it can't do
-**Provide metrics** - Performance numbers, benchmarks
-**Explain why** - Technical reasoning matters
-**Link to docs** - Make it easy to try
### DON'T:
-**Use marketing jargon** - "Revolutionary", "game-changing"
-**Oversimplify** - Developers can handle complexity
-**Hide limitations** - They'll find them anyway
-**Make unsubstantiated claims** - Back it up with data
-**Skip code examples** - Abstract descriptions fail
---
## Messaging Framework
### Problem Statement
**Format:** [Current pain point] → [Why existing solutions fail] → [Impact on developers]
**Example:**
"Debugging distributed systems is painful. Traditional logging tools weren't built for microservices, forcing developers to manually correlate logs across dozens of services. This turns a 5-minute bug into a 5-hour investigation."
---
### Solution Overview
**Format:** [What it is] → [How it works (technical)] → [Key benefit]
**Example:**
"Distributed Tracer automatically instruments your services to create a unified view of requests across your entire stack. Using OpenTelemetry standards, it correlates logs, metrics, and traces in real-time, reducing MTTR by 80%."
---
### Key Differentiators
**Format:** [Feature] → [Technical implementation] → [Why it matters]
**Example:**
"Zero-config auto-instrumentation. Our SDK uses bytecode injection to automatically trace all HTTP calls, database queries, and external APIs without code changes. Deploy in under 5 minutes instead of days."

## Positioning Statements
### General Template
"For [target developers] who [need/pain point], [Product] is a [category] that [key benefit]. Unlike [alternatives], we [unique differentiation]."
### Examples
**API Tool:**
"For backend developers who need reliable API integrations, FastAPI Connect is an API orchestration platform that auto-retries, caches, and monitors all external calls. Unlike building retry logic yourself, we provide production-grade reliability out of the box."
**Developer Platform:**
"For platform teams building internal developer platforms, DevHub is a self-service portal that gives developers one-click access to infrastructure. Unlike traditional ticketing systems, we automate provisioning in seconds instead of days."

## Avoiding Common Mistakes
### Mistake 1: Too Abstract
**Bad:** "Simplify your workflow"
**Good:** "Reduce deployment time from 45 minutes to 2 minutes"
### Mistake 2: Jargon Overload
**Bad:** "Leverage synergistic paradigms"
**Good:** "Run the same code on AWS, GCP, and Azure"
### Mistake 3: No Proof
**Bad:** "The fastest API"
**Good:** "p99 latency < 50ms (see benchmark: [link])"
### Mistake 4: Feature List
**Bad:** "Includes caching, retries, and monitoring"
**Good:** "Auto-retry failed requests up to 3x with exponential backoff"
### Mistake 5: Ignoring Migration
**Bad:** [No mention of existing solutions]
**Good:** "Migrate from [Competitor] in under 1 hour: [guide]"

## Decision Framework
### Scoring System
Use the `assess_launch_tier.sh` script or manually score:
**Score Components:**
1. **Type of Launch** (0-10 points)
- New product/GA: 10
- Major version: 8
- New feature: 5
- Improvement: 2
- Bug fix: 0
2. **User Impact** (0-10 points)
- All users (100%): 10
- Most users (50-99%): 7
- Segment (25-50%): 5
- Small segment (<25%): 2
- Beta only: 1
3. **Revenue Impact** (0-10 points)
- New revenue stream: 10
- Major driver: 7
- Moderate: 4
- Minor: 2
- None: 0
4. **Competitive Differentiation** (0-8 points)
- Industry first: 8
- Significant: 6
- Some: 4
- Parity: 1
- None: 0
5. **Technical Complexity** (0-7 points)
- New platform: 7
- Significant: 5
- Moderate: 3
- Simple: 1
- Minor: 0
6. **Documentation Needs** (0-6 points)
- Complete new set: 6
- Major updates: 5
- New guides: 3
- Updates: 1
- Release notes only: 0
7. **External Interest** (0-7 points)
- High (industry news): 7
- Moderate (tech press): 5
- Some (community): 3
- Low (niche): 1
- Minimal: 0
**Total Score: 0-58**
**Tier Assignment:**
- **40-58:** Tier 1 (Major)
- **20-39:** Tier 2 (Standard)
- **0-19:** Tier 3 (Minor)
---
## Common Scenarios
### Scenario 1: API GA Launch
**Type:** New product
**Users:** All (new audience)
**Revenue:** New stream
**Competitive:** Industry first capability
**Technical:** New platform
**Docs:** Complete set
**Interest:** High
**Score:** 52 → **Tier 1**
---
### Scenario 2: New Language SDK
**Type:** New integration
**Users:** Segment (e.g., Python devs)
**Revenue:** Moderate impact
**Competitive:** Parity
**Technical:** Moderate
**Docs:** New guide
**Interest:** Some
**Score:** 25 → **Tier 2**
---
### Scenario 3: Performance Update
**Type:** Improvement
**Users:** All
**Revenue:** None direct
**Competitive:** None
**Technical:** Simple
**Docs:** Updates
**Interest:** Low
**Score:** 12 → **Tier 3**

## Why Developer Metrics Are Different
Developer products have unique characteristics:
- **High technical barriers** to adoption
- **Longer evaluation** periods
- **Community-driven** growth
- **Usage-based** pricing models
- **Quality over quantity** (one great developer > 100 casual users)
Traditional B2B SaaS metrics don't always apply directly.
---
## The Developer Funnel
```
Awareness → Interest → Evaluation → Activation → Engagement → Retention → Monetization
```
Each stage has specific metrics.

## 5. Engagement Metrics
### Active Usage
**Daily/Weekly/Monthly Active Developers (DAD/WAD/MAD):**
```
DAD = Unique developers making API calls daily
WAD = Unique developers active weekly
MAD = Unique developers active monthly
```
**Stickiness:**
```
Stickiness = DAD / MAD
```
- Target: > 20% (good)
- Target: > 40% (excellent)
**API Usage:**
- **Total API calls** per day/week/month
- **API calls per developer**
- **Endpoints used** per developer
- **Error rate** (target: < 1%)
**Feature Adoption:**
- % of developers using key features
- Time to feature adoption
- Feature depth (how many features per user)
**Targets:**
- 40%+ stickiness (DAD/MAD)
- 1K+ API calls per active developer per month
- < 1% error rate
- 3+ features adopted per developer
---
## 6. Retention Metrics
### Developer Retention
**Cohort Retention:**
```
Day 1 Retention = Developers active on Day 1 / Total sign-ups
Day 7 Retention = Developers active on Day 7 / Total sign-ups
Day 30 Retention = Developers active on Day 30 / Total sign-ups
```
**Typical Developer Product Retention:**
- Day 1: 60-70%
- Day 7: 30-50%
- Day 30: 20-40%
- Day 90: 15-30%
**Why Developer Retention Is Lower:**
- Evaluation period (many are just testing)
- Project-based usage (finish project, stop using)
- This is normal and expected
**Churn Rate:**
```
Monthly Churn = Developers who stopped using / Active developers at month start
```
**Resurrection Rate:**
```
Resurrection = Churned developers who return / Total churned developers
```
**Targets:**
- < 5% monthly churn (paid users)
- 40%+ Day 7 retention
- 25%+ Day 30 retention

## Developer Satisfaction
### Net Promoter Score (NPS)
Survey question: "How likely are you to recommend [product] to other developers?"
**Scale:** 0-10
**Calculation:**
```
NPS = % Promoters (9-10) - % Detractors (0-6)
```
**Developer Product Benchmarks:**
- **Excellent:** NPS > 50
- **Good:** NPS 30-50
- **Needs Work:** NPS < 30

## Common Pitfalls
### Vanity Metrics
**Avoid:**
- Total registered users (most are inactive)
- Total API calls (could be from one user)
- GitHub stars alone (may not use product)
**Focus on:**
- Active users (making API calls)
- Retained users (coming back)
- Engaged users (using multiple features)
### Wrong Benchmarks
Don't compare developer product metrics to:
- B2C social apps (much higher DAU/MAU)
- Enterprise SaaS (lower volume, higher ACV)
- E-commerce (transactional, not sustained use)
Use developer product benchmarks instead.

## Developer Metric Formulas
Quick reference:
```
Activation Rate = Activated Users / Sign-ups
Stickiness = DAD / MAD
Churn Rate = Users Lost / Total Users
NRR = (MRR + Expansion - Churn) / Starting MRR
LTV = ARPU / Churn Rate
CAC Payback = CAC / (ARPU * Gross Margin)
```
**Remember:** Metrics should drive action, not just reporting. If a metric doesn't change behavior, don't track it.
